Chandigarh 6-Day Itinerary

Saturday, September 2: Exploring the City

Start your trip in Chandigarh, known for its modern architecture and urban planning. In the morning, visit the Rock Garden, a unique sculpture garden created by artist Nek Chand. Spend the afternoon exploring the Capitol Complex, designed by renowned architect Le Corbusier. In the evening, take a leisurely walk at Sukhna Lake and enjoy the serene surroundings.

  • Rock Garden: Estimated Cost - INR 30, Estimated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Capitol Complex: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Sukhna Lake: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 1-2 hours
Sunday, September 3: Historical Sites

Explore the historical sites of Chandigarh on the second day. Start your morning at the Chandigarh Museum and Art Gallery, housing a diverse collection of artifacts. In the afternoon, visit the beautiful Zakir Hussain Rose Garden, home to thousands of rose varieties. End your day with a visit to the serene and grandeur of the Gurudwara Nada Sahib.

  • Chandigarh Museum and Art Gallery: Estimated Cost - INR 10, Estimated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Zakir Hussain Rose Garden: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Gurudwara Nada Sahib: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 1-2 hours

Wednesday, September 6: Excursion to Pinjore Gardens

Embark on a day trip to the nearby Pinjore Gardens, also known as the Yadavindra Gardens. Spend the day exploring the beautiful Mughal-style gardens, pavilions, and fountains. Enjoy a picnic amidst the scenic surroundings and take a leisurely stroll through the lush greenery.

  • Pinjore Gardens: Estimated Cost - INR 20, Estimated Time Spent - 3-4 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, head to the Nek Chand's Fantasy Rock Garden Extension, an extension of the iconic Rock Garden. It features more intricate sculptures and hidden corners. Another local favorite is the Chandigarh Architecture Museum, which provides insights into the city's architectural marvels and urban planning. Don't miss the opportunity to sample street food at the popular Sector 22 market, where you can savor local delicacies like chole bhature and golgappas.
